Ghana’s National Theatre to undergo major rehabilitation as government plans new facility in Kumasi

Share this:

“Mr. Speaker, in 2026, government will rehabilitate the National Theatre in Accra. We will also commence site acquisition and design of a second national theatre in Kumasi,” Dr Cassiel Ato Forson stated.

Mahama announces start of Kumasi Western Bypass under ‘Big Push Programme’

Share this:

“Under the Big Push Programme, we will begin the construction of the Kumasi Western Bypass. This will significantly reduce unnecessary traffic, particularly from heavy articulated cargo trucks passing through the city. They will have an alternative route connecting the Mampong and Techiman roads via Ejisu,” he stated.

John Mahama Reaffirms Commitment to Modernize Accra’s National Theatre and Build a Second One in Kumasi

Share this:

“A lot of things are in bad shape at the theatre. The curtains cannot be drawn, and the stage is in bad shape, so it is time for us to rehabilitate the building to help the creative industry,” Mahama said. He outlined plans to modernize the theatre with new equipment, transforming it into a state-of-the-art creative hub capable of supporting artists nationwide.
